Low Income & Subsidized Housing in Wyoming
200 assisted properties with about 8,342 subsidized units, drawn from HUD administrative records. Typical tenant-paid rent across them averages around $386/mo.
76
PB Section 8 buildings
4
public housing developments
124
LIHTC tax-credit properties
18
cities with inventory
Largest cities for low income housing in Wyoming
| City | Properties | Assisted units | Avg rent range |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cheyenne | 30 | 1,857 | $312–$495 |
| Casper | 30 | 1,634 | $234–$379 |
| Gillette | 16 | 803 | $272–$406 |
| Sheridan | 16 | 694 | $381–$442 |
| Rock Springs | 6 | 417 | $322–$443 |
| Laramie | 10 | 309 | $382–$424 |
| Riverton | 11 | 304 | $350–$419 |
| Evanston | 8 | 279 | $416–$416 |
| Douglas | 8 | 253 | $297–$479 |
| Rawlins | 5 | 235 | $246–$249 |
| Jackson | 8 | 225 | — |
| Cody | 9 | 203 | $434–$434 |
| Green River | 4 | 203 | $453–$453 |
| Torrington | 6 | 155 | $295–$412 |
| Worland | 4 | 85 | $426–$443 |
| Powell | 5 | 83 | $420–$420 |
| Lander | 3 | 80 | $300–$300 |
| Wheatland | 3 | 57 | $390–$407 |
